Population Overview

White County is located in Indiana with a total population of 24,717. It is the 62nd most populous county out of 92 in Indiana. The county encompasses 10 Census-designated places.

Age Demographics

The median age in White County is 42.8 years. This is 12% higher than the state median of 38.1 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in White County is $67,303. This is 6% lower than the state median of $71,957. It is also 17% lower than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 10.2%. This is 18% lower than the state poverty rate of 12.3%. The unemployment rate is 3.5%. This is 18% lower than the state rate of 4.3%. The median home value is $175,900. Housing costs are 19% lower than the state median of $218,200.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.6x, White County is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 81.0%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 15% higher than the state average of 70.5%.

Race & Ethnicity

White County has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 85.8%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 10.8%. The Black or African American population (0.5%) is well below the state average of 9.1%. The Asian population (0.3%) is well below the state average of 2.6%.

Education

19.2%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 35% lower than the state rate of 29.5%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 90.6%.
